WebAug 10, 2014 · It is not insignificant that Jesus retreats to the mountain while he has sent his disciples out into the raging chaos of the sea. The mountain in Matthew’s Gospel is a place for encountering God and hearing the proclamation of God’s glorious kingdom (e.g., 5:1-7:29; 17:1-8). WebApr 24, 2024 · Matthew 10:1-42. WebMar 14, 2024 · Various names and titles belong to Jesus Christ, the Son of God and the second Person of the triune Godhead. His personal name is Jesus, meaning “savior.” Christ is the Lord’s title and means “anointed one.” For thousands of years, Israel looked forward to the arrival of an anointed Savior promised by God and foretold by Israel’s prophets (Daniel …
